The banks made a small private company the owner of record of most of the 
mortgages made during the boom. The problem? The owner of record is supposed to 
be the trusts whose holdings make up the RBS'es.

It ain't just some 'missing paperwork'. It's entirely possible that no one 
actually knows who owns what by now. The next economic bubble might well be 
real estate litigation if the 'smnartest guys in the room' can only figure out 
how to securitize that....
